Classification Drug Onset Peak Duration Rapid-acting Lispro insulin (Humalog) Less than 15 min 30 min to 1 hr 3 to 4 hr Short-acting Regular insulin (Humulin R) 30 min to 1 hr 2 to 3 hr 5 to 7 hr Intermediate-acting NPH insulin (Humulin N) 1 to 2 hr 4 to 12 hr 18 to 24 hr Long-acting Insulin glargine (Lantus) 1 hr None - Levels are steady 24 hr

ACTIVE LEARNING TEMPLATE: Medication Suzette Hansen STUDENT NAME_ Lispro Insulin (rapid-acting) MEDICATION_ REVIEWInsulin pumps generally use rapid-acting insulin formulations (i.e., insulin lispro, aspart, or glulisine). Lispro and aspart are approved by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) for use in a pump insulin reservoir for up to 144 hours, but glulisine should be replaced every 48 hours due to a risk of crystallization.

Insulin Lispro is an analog insulin. It is made by genetically modifying the structure of human insulin to allow it to be absorbed more quickly and last for a shorter length of time than regular insulin. Lispro: Starts working within 0 to 15 minutes after administration. Peaks in 30 to 90 minutes. Keeps working for less than five hours (usually ...

Insulin lispro is an insulin analog that is FDA-approved for the treatment of patients with diabetes mellitus types 1 and 2 to control hyperglycemia. Its off-label uses include treating patients with mild-to-moderate diabetic ketoacidosis, gestational diabetes mellitus, and mild-to-moderate hyperosmolar hyperglycemic state.
